Frequently Asked Questions
What is the primary basis for classifying computers?
Computers are primarily classified based on their physical size, computational power, and intended use, such as personal computers, supercomputers, and embedded systems.
Can you give an example of a special-purpose computer?
A special-purpose computer is designed for a specific task, such as an embedded system in a car's engine control unit or a microcontroller in a smartwatch.
What distinguishes a supercomputer from other types of computers?
Supercomputers are distinguished by their high-performance computing capabilities, which allow them to perform complex calculations at extremely fast speeds, often used in scientific research and simulations.
How do microcomputers differ from mainframes?
Microcomputers, such as personal computers and laptops, are smaller and less powerful than mainframes, which are large, high-capacity systems designed for enterprise-level computing tasks.
What role do integrated circuits play in modern computing devices?
Integrated circuits are essential components in modern computing devices, as they integrate multiple electronic components onto a single chip, enabling the miniaturization and increased functionality of computers.
